Find the distance between each pair of points (-4,6) and (3,-7)

Answers

Answer:

Here is your answer . Hope this helps you.

Answer:

[tex]\boxed {\boxed {\sf \sqrt{218} \ or \ 14.76}}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for calculating the distance between 2 points is:

[tex]d= \sqrt{(x_2-x_1)^2 +(y_2-y_1)^2[/tex]

In this formula, (x₁, y₁) and (x₂, y₂) are the 2 points. The 2 points we are given are (-4, 6) and (3, -7). If we match the value with the corresponding variable we see that:

x₁ = -4 y₁ = 6 x₂ = 3 y₂ = -7

Substitute the values into the formula.

[tex]d= \sqrt{(3 - -4)^2 + (-7-6)^2[/tex]

Solve inside the parentheses.

(3--4) = (3+4) = 7 (-7-6) = -13

[tex]d=\sqrt {(7)^2 + (-13)^2[/tex]

Solve the exponents.

(7)²= 7*7 = 49 (-13)² = -13 * -13 = 169

[tex]d= \sqrt{ (49)+(169)[/tex]

Add.

[tex]d= \sqrt{218}[/tex]

[tex]d=14.76482306[/tex]

If we round to the nearest hundredth place, the 4 in the thousandth place tells us to leave the 6.

[tex]d \approx 14.76[/tex]

The distance between the points (-4, 6) and (3, -7) is √218 or approximately 14.76.

In a hotel, 40 people occupy excatly 26 rooms. Each room is occupied by either one or two people. How many rooms are occupied by exactly one person?

Answers

Answer:  12 rooms

Explanation:

Let's say that the first 26 people will occupy each of the 26 rooms. This means that, so far, there's one person per room.

There are 40-26 = 14 people left. Let's say those 14 people occupy the first 14 rooms. This means that the first 14 rooms now have 2 people in them per room. The remaining 26-14 = 12 rooms still have one person per room.
